Huabao International Holdings Limited reported in its Next Day Disclosure Return that:
• Issued shares unchanged: As of 20 July 2026, total issued ordinary shares remain at 3.23 billion, reflecting no allotments or cancellations since the previous disclosure dated 17 July 2026.
• Fresh on-market repurchase: On 20 July 2026, the company bought back 250,000 shares on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ange at HKD 2.86–2.87 per share, paying HKD 0.72 million in aggregate. These shares are earmarked for cancellation.
• Cumulative 2026 buybacks: Including the latest transaction, Huabao has repurchased 5.79 million shares between 22 May and 20 July 2026 at prices ranging from HKD 2.87 to HKD 3.80, all pending cancellation. The cumulative volume represents 0.18 % of the 3.23 billion shares in issue when the 10 % buyback mandate (authorising up to 322.84 million shares) was approved on 11 May 2026.
• Capacity remaining: After the 5.79 million shares already repurchased, approximately 317.05 million shares, or 9.82 % of issued capital, remain available under the current mandate.
• Moratorium on new issues: In line with Hong Kong listing requirements, Huabao is restricted from issuing new shares or selling treasury shares until 19 August 2026, being 30 days after the latest repurchase.
All repurchases were conducted in accordance with the Main Board Listing Rules, and all necessary authorisations and filings have been confirmed by the company.
